Inventhelp Inventor Develops Improved Burial Casket Lid Design (ROH-652)


(MENAFN- PR Newswire)

PITTSBURGH, March 19, 2025 /PRNewswire/ -- "We wanted to create a modified casket that would offer an easier and more dramatic means of closing the casket lid," said one of two inventors, from Ypsilanti, Mich., "so we invented the CLOSURE MOMENTS, WIFI CONTROL CASKET LID. Our automated design would ensure the seal between the lid and the rest of the casket was as tight as possible without requiring excessive strength by the funeral worker. It would also provide a sense of drama for the final viewing."

The patent-pending invention provides an improved design for a burial casket. In doing so, it offers an easy and automated way to close the casket lid. As a result, it eliminates the need to manually close the lid. It also may offer a more dramatic final viewing of the deceased. The invention features an innovative design that is easy to operate so it is ideal for funeral homes, funeral directors, etc.
